RALEIGH, N.C. — A man, who was wanted for a probation violation, was arrested Friday after he fled the scene of a traffic collision, authorities said.

According to arrest warrants, Robert Timothy Atkins, of 3310 Wickslow Road in Wilmington, was involved in a traffic collision at 8408 Saltwood Lane in Raleigh.

Instead of alerting authorities to the crash, Atkins continued to drive the vehicle, which had been reported stolen, until he was arrested on Brier Creek Parkway, authorities said.

Atkins was charged with fleeing to elude arrest, possession of a stolen vehicle, failure to stop after an accident resulting in property damage and violating probation.

According to state Department of Correction records, Atkins was charged with DWI, reckless driving, speeding and identity theft in September.At the time of that arrest, Atkins listed 10260 Strome Ave. in Raleigh as his home address.

Atkins was given probation for a December 2008 drug possession conviction. He had a previous drug conviction in Florida.

Atkins was being held Saturday in the Wake County jail under an $85,000 bond. He is due in court on Monday.
